Output efed95670cf5c409c853bd591349ec9adae267a5132d72de3ee79ea7c3b746b8:0

value
22560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78118105803db8239d59e357edf72999522c9394 OP_EQUAL
address
3Cdsym9VwPzkLWxpFoupTzsmbrejiYK8kk
transaction
efed95670cf5c409c853bd591349ec9adae267a5132d72de3ee79ea7c3b746b8
confirmations
175467
spent
true